Frances “Ann” Meador, 94, of Asheville, NC, passed peacefully on February 27, 2025.
Born in Stillwater, OK, on July 5, 1930, to O.A. Hilton and Clymena Logan Hilton, she attended Oklahoma State University, earning her BA in English. Married to R. Roy Meador, Jr of Clearwater, FL, in 1952, they settled in Leesburg, FL. They raised three daughters, Rebecca A. Walsh, Toni L. Meador, and M. Melinda Meador. Ann was preceded in death by her husband, Roy, in 2004. Her three grandchildren, Flannery Gray Ballard of Juneau, AK, Killian Rose Ballard of Seattle, WA, and Parrish Lachlan Ballard of Juneau, AK, as well as her twin sister and brother, Janet Heightsmith, 90, of Denver, CO, and Jerold Hilton of St. George, UT, mourn her passing.
Ann’s life was a tapestry of roles and experiences. She was a musician, homemaker, teacher, author, shop owner, and quilter. Her versatility was evident in her membership in the choir of the First Presbyterian Church in Leesburg, FL., and her founding of New Life Presbyterian Church in Fruitland Park, FL.
Following a month-long trip from her home in Leesburg, FL, to their summer home in Franklin, NC, in an Amish wagon pulled by their mule Jack and their dog, Sigmund, for company, she wrote and published a book “Ain’t You Got no Cah?, detailing their journey. She loved to travel and accompanied her daughter on postings to Beijing and Buenos Aires.
As Ann’s adventures started to slow, she found solace in the simple pleasures of life. She resided with her daughter in Asheville and settled at Deerfield Retirement Center. Her love for nature was evident in her fondness for roses, dahlias, and bird watching. Her spiritual connection stayed strong through her online participation with New Hope Presbyterian Church, and her love for hymns was a constant in her life.
